Re: Armed to the teeth (SCA).

Sheathed swords are a problem as they can block leg shots. Back-up weapons tend to be smaller and less likely to interfere with shots especially if they are in the small of your back or on your shield side. If you get hit in your weapon, you should take it as a good hit, since gauging telling blows...

FYI I got stabbed by one of these at the war practice last Sunday. It doesn't hit any harder; what it does is land with more definition than a typical 3" padded tip. The shots that would land and not be noticed because they're squashy get noticed because they're more defined. Blackbow hmmmm......
